President of NFDMA is Outraged at Airing of ‘Best Funeral Ever’

In an official press release emailed out late Tuesday evening NFDMA President Gregory T. Burrell stated his outrage over the airing of the TLC reality show ‘Best Funeral Ever’.

From NFDMA:

Gregory T. Burrell, President of the National Funeral Directors and Morticians
Association, Inc., along with many other funeral professionals across the country, is
outraged at the airing of the show “Best Funeral Ever”. We want to express our
sincere apology to those persons who are experiencing the loss of a loved one and
were subject to the airing of the show.

It is the position of the National Funeral Directors and Morticians Association,
Inc. that we are not in favor of any person or media which degrades the funeral
industry. The funeral profession is above many others because it is one that must
console those who deal with personal crisis while battling through grief and dealing
with the loss of a loved one. The show, “Best Funeral Ever” is not an
appropriate subject matter in light of the tragedies we have just witnessed in
Connecticut.

We would like to express to the general public and media that this show does not in
any way reflect how most funeral service professionals conduct funeral services.
Our industry colleagues conduct dignified, sacred and professional services to honor
the life of the deceased person. We are very disappointed that the TLC network
would use the media to produce and air a show which would not do the same.
